计算机学院校友网站开发全攻略:源码+文档+部署
版权申诉
174 浏览量
更新于2024-11-22
收藏 33.17MB ZIP 举报
资源摘要信息:"java毕业设计之基于springboot的计算机学院校友网站"
知识点:
1. Java毕业设计:Java毕业设计是指大学计算机专业学生在毕业之前为了完成学业,需要独立完成的一个具有创新性和实践性的项目,通常要求学生应用所学知识解决实际问题,构建一个完整的软件系统。
2. SpringBoot框架:SpringBoot是一个基于Spring的一个全新框架,目的是简化Spring应用的初始搭建以及开发过程。SpringBoot自动配置了许多传统配置,使得开发者可以集中精力于业务代码的开发,提高开发效率和项目构建的速度。
3. Vue.js前端框架:Vue.js是一个轻量级的前端JavaScript框架,专注于视图层,具有易上手、高效、组件化的特点。在本项目中,Vue.js与SpringBoot结合使用,形成了前后端分离的开发模式。
4. JDK版本要求:JDK 1.8是Java开发工具包的一个版本,通常称为Java 8,它包含了Java虚拟机、Java类库等工具,是进行Java开发的基础环境。
5. MySQL数据库:MySQL是一个流行的开源关系型数据库管理系统,广泛用于网站后台数据存储。本项目中使用MySQL 5.7版本存储校友网站的数据。
6. 开发环境搭建:项目开发需要配置开发环境,本项目支持在Eclipse和IDEA两种流行的集成开发环境(IDE)中进行开发,Eclipse和IDEA各有特点,但都能提供高效的代码编写、调试和项目管理功能。
7. 计算机学院校友网站功能:计算机学院校友网站是一个面向校友的交流平台,提供了校友信息显示、校友分会管理、订单审核、留言回复等服务。管理员可以进行校友分会的增加、删除、修改和查询,处理校友分会的预订订单,查看订单评价和打分,回复用户留言等。
8. 数据库设计:在计算机学院校友网站中,需要创建相应的数据表来存储校友、分会、订单、留言等信息。合理地设计数据库表结构是保证系统性能和数据安全的前提。
9. 系统测试:系统开发完成后,需要经过严格的测试过程,包括单元测试、集成测试、系统测试和用户接受测试等,以确保系统稳定、可靠并且满足需求。
10. 代码注释:代码注释是编写代码的一个重要部分,它可以帮助开发者理解代码的功能和实现细节,也可以为维护人员提供必要的信息,提升代码的可读性和可维护性。
11. 源码部署:源码部署是将开发完成的软件部署到服务器上,使之能够运行和对外提供服务。本项目提供部署说明文档,帮助用户快速部署和使用系统。
12. 报告文档与PPT:项目完成后的文档编写是重要的环节,万字报告文档将详细介绍项目的开发过程、功能实现、设计思路和使用说明等。PPT则可作为项目汇报或答辩的演示材料。
以上知识点涉及了整个项目从开发环境搭建到实际开发、系统测试和部署的全过程,为Java编程、SpringBoot框架应用、数据库设计、前端技术等多个方面提供了详细的信息。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2024-04-12 上传
2024-03-12 上传
2023-11-22 上传
2024-03-29 上传
2024-08-23 上传
2024-03-04 上传
爱coding的同学
- 粉丝: 701
- 资源: 757
最新资源
- Raspberry Pi OpenCL驱动程序安装与QEMU仿真指南
- Apache RocketMQ Go客户端:全面支持与消息处理功能
- WStage平台:无线传感器网络阶段数据交互技术
- 基于Java SpringBoot和微信小程序的ssm智能仓储系统开发
- CorrectMe项目:自动更正与建议API的开发与应用
- IdeaBiz请求处理程序JAVA:自动化API调用与令牌管理
- 墨西哥面包店研讨会:介绍关键业绩指标(KPI)与评估标准
- 2014年Android音乐播放器源码学习分享
- CleverRecyclerView扩展库:滑动效果与特性增强
- 利用Python和SURF特征识别斑点猫图像
- Wurpr开源PHP MySQL包装器:安全易用且高效
- Scratch少儿编程:Kanon妹系闹钟音效素材包
- 食品分享社交应用的开发教程与功能介绍
- Cookies by lfj.io: 浏览数据智能管理与同步工具
- 掌握SSH框架与SpringMVC Hibernate集成教程
- C语言实现FFT算法及互相关性能优化指南